    1. Identify the Right Certification 

    The first step in the certification journey is to identify the most relevant and beneficial certification programs for your developers. With numerous options available, focusing on certifications that align with your project needs and developers’ career goals is crucial. Consider programs that cover a broad spectrum of full-stack technologies, including front-end languages like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, back-end technologies such as Node.js or Ruby on Rails, and essential database management skills.

    ● Exploring Options: Research well-recognized certification bodies such as the Technology Certification Council or specific tech companies like Microsoft and Amazon that offer specialized programs. Evaluate the curriculum for comprehensive coverage that ensures a deep understanding of full-stack development principles and practices. 

    2. Prepare for the Certification 

    Once a suitable certification is chosen, the next step involves thorough preparation. Full-stack development certifications often encompass a wide range of topics, requiring a solid study plan and dedication. 

    ● Study Materials and Resources: Utilize the wealth of study materials provided by certification bodies, including textbooks, online courses, and practice exams. Encourage developers to engage in hands-on projects that complement theoretical knowledge, enhancing their learning experience. 

    ● Peer Study Groups: Facilitate the formation of study groups within your team, fostering a collaborative learning environment. Sharing insights and tackling complex problems together can significantly boost understanding and retention of key concepts. 

    3. Scheduling the Exam 

    With preparation underway, scheduling the certification exam is a critical logistical step. Exam dates may be subject to availability, so it’s important to plan accordingly, allowing ample time for study and review. 

    ● Registration Process: Navigate the registration process outlined by the certification authority, paying attention to deadlines, fees, and any prerequisites. Consider

    scheduling exams during periods that minimize conflict with project deadlines, reducing stress for your developers.

    8. Tracking ROI of Certification Efforts 

    Investing in certification for full-stack developers is a strategic move, but like all investments, it’s important to track the return. Monitor the impact of certification on project outcomes, developer productivity, and overall team performance. Assess whether certified knowledge has led to the adoption of new technologies, methodologies, or efficiencies within your projects. 

    ● Measuring Success: Use key performance indicators (KPIs) relevant to your organization’s goals, such as time-to-market, bug rates, or customer satisfaction scores, to measure the tangible benefits of certification. This data can help justify further investment in certifications and guide decisions on which certifications to pursue in the future.
